Subject: Quickstore 4.2 — bloom filter now fronts the KV layer

Plugin authors: starting with this release, Quickstore places a bloom filter ahead of the key-value store. Negative lookups return faster; false positives fall through safely. No API changes are required on your side. Verify your plugin against the staging build referenced below.

session token of fahif-tadup = htk3_9c7

Ticket: drift detected on Tailgrip, our internal CLI for log tailing. New folks, note that the Harlsden bastion hosts were provisioned with an older follow-buffer setting, so output stutters there while the Ostvale hosts stream smoothly. The fix is to reconverge everything against the canonical profile. The values every host should carry after reconvergence appear directly below.

service settings:
[quenath]
host = quenath.zemvarcorp.corp
user = quenath_svc
database = quenath_prod

// DEFAULT_DATE_PATTERN — fallback used when the Lanternfall locale
// service returns no pattern for a user's region.
//
// Do not localize this constant directly; per-locale overrides live in
// the Wrenhaven translation bundles and take precedence at render time.
// Changing the fallback silently shifts date order for any region the
// bundle misses, which broke receipts for three markets last quarter.
// Verify against the bundle snapshot before approving edits here.
// The snapshot was generated by the build identified below.

pipeline stamp: htk3_cc5

HANDOVER — autocomplete index latency

For the release manager: the Thornquist autocomplete index is rebuilding too slowly after the tokenizer change, pushing p95 lookups past 400ms. Partial fix merged; incremental rebuild flag still off in staging. Do not ship until rebuild times are verified. Remaining work and final verification belong to the engineer named below.

approver of yajef-fajef = Oliwyn Silion Kasok Kasox